Loews Portofino Bay Resort Construction
Universal and Loews began quietly updating the room and guests areas around the Portofino Bay Resort recently. This means construction crews could be working on guest rooms or public areas close to your rooms. TouringPlans forums users report that construction is limited to the late morning to early afternoon to avoid disrupting guest’s stays. At this time no resort amenities such as pools, restaurants, or lobby are affected.
To avoid locations with construction call Loews Portofino Bay, (407) 503-1000, within a week of your visit.
Jake’s Beer Dinner
Royal Pacific Resort welcomes 3 Daughters Brewing of St Petersburgh, FL, as the latest brewery featured at Jake’s Beer Dinner. Tickets include beer, five course dinner with pairings, and free self parking. Tickets are on sale now for $55 per person plus tax.

Weather
Winter weather patterns routinely come as far south as Orlando, so pack for the weather. Volcano Bay could experience a delayed opening or closure when highs are in the 60s and lows in the 40s. Refer to Universal Orlando’s Twitter account for the latest operating information.

Events & Festivals
Deck the halls at Universal Orlando Resort November 16, 2019 – January 5, 2020 with their annual Holiday festivities. Join The Grinch in Seuss Landing and see a live performance of How the Grinch Stole Christmas, celebrate in Universal Studios Florida with Universal’s Holiday Parade featuring Macy’s, or visit the Wizarding World decked out in Christmas decorations.
